TransWave Photonics, LLC proposes to demonstrate a new active region and thermal packaging configuration for the mid-wave infrared quantum cascade lasers that provide both high modal overlap with the laser active region and a dramatically reduced thermal impedance of the laser compared to the current state-of-the-art. The proposed laser design concept allows for scaling of continuous-wave power output from mid-wave infrared quantum cascade lasers beyond the current state-of-the-art. In Phase II, the proposing team will demonstrate a single QCL device producing > 5 W room temperature continuous wave optical power with diffraction limited beam by improving thermal impedance of the device by a factor of two.
